A scientist studied the relationship between the number of trees,x, per acre and the number of birds, y, per acre in a neighborhood. She modeled the relationship with a scatter plot and used the equation y=4+6x for the regression line. 

What is the meaning of the slope and y-intercept of this regression line?

The slope is 6. This means that for every 1 additional tree, she can expect an average of 6 additional birds per acre. The y-intercept is 4. This means that the average number of birds per acre in an area with no trees is 4.

Consider the function for cell duplication. The cells duplicate every minute.

                                       f(x)=75(2)x

What do the values 75 and 2 represent in relation to the duplication of these cells.

The 75 is the initial number of cells, and the 2 indicates that the number of cells doubles every minute.
